Rust Console launch date has been announced

Rust, the acclaimed multiplayer survival simulator, is coming to consoles on May 21, 2021. The announcement was made last weekend by the game studio Double Eleven. They also posted a trailer for Rust Console, which you can check out below.

The PC version of Rust hit the market back in 2013. But since 2016, developers have been trying to adapt the game for consoles. The main difficulty was the problem of productivity. Rust Console has to deal with the fact that consoles aren’t as easy to improve as PCs. That is why the creators had to rewrite most of the engine to adapt it for the consoles’ capabilities. The updates for the console and PC versions will be separate for the same reason.

At the beginning of development, it took almost an hour to launch the game on Playstation. Thanks to the developers’ efforts, the launch-time was reduced to a minute.

It’s worth noting that the Rust Console will be available for more than just next-gen. The studio aimed at the Playstation 4 and Xbox One during the creative process. But thanks to backward compatibility, Playstation 5 and Xbox Series X \ S owners will also be able to enjoy the game.
